Manchester United Battle Chelsea For Tottenham's Nigerian Whizkid
Published: March 29, 2018Manchester United must see off competition from Premier League rivals Chelsea to sign Nigerian wonderkid Nonso Madueke, according to reports.
Allnigeriasoccer.com previously reported that United have set the ball rolling in their bid to sign the promising midfielder after including the Tottenham Hotspur starlet on their roster for the ongoing Mediterranean International Cup in Spain.
Now the Daily Mail has added that Madueke is also attracting interest from Chelsea.
Born March 10, 2002, the 16-year-old is expected to sign a scholarship deal if he remains at Tottenham Hotspur next season, but this is unlikely to be the case with the London club permitting him to train with the Red Devils.
Manchester United and Chelsea have been following the progress of Madueke for more than ten months, having scouted him at the Torneo Delle Nazioni in Gradisca d’Isonzo, Italy towards the end of last season.
Madueke made his debut for Spurs U18 team against Aston Villa in February 2017 but has not featured for that age group in the U18 Premier League, Premier League Cup and FA Youth Cup this season amid speculation surrounding a potential move away from the club.
